On 2021-03-17 05:05, Matt Borchers wrote:

> It feels like an unfinished addition or incomplete feature to actively prevent 'First, 'Last, etc. from returning something reasonable about the sub-type in question.  Return SOMETHING, even if it pertains to the parent type, and let the programmer decide how it can be useful to them.  Using my LETTERS and CURVED_LETTERS example, I still don't see why the following would be problematic:
> 
> A <= LETTERS'First
> K <= LETTERS'Last
> 11 <= LETTERS'Length
> 1 <= LETTERS'Pos(B)
> 10 <= LETTERS'Pos(J)
> 
> B <= CURVED_LETTERS'First
> J <= CURVED_LETTERS'Last
> 5 <= CURVED_LETTERS'Length
> 0 <= CURVED_LETTERS'Pos(B)
> 4 <= CURVED_LETTERS'Pos(J)
> 
> I didn't address 'Succ and 'Pred, but these also seem reasonable.

Consider this:

    function Count (A : LETTERS) return Natural is
       Count : Natural := 0;
    begin
       for I in A'First..A'Last loop
          Count := Count + 1;
       end loop;
    end Count;

How this supposed to be compiled? Note that CURVED_LETTERS is a subtype 
of LETTERS. So you can pass CURVED_LETTERS to Count.

Count cannot use LETTERS'First, 'Succ etc in its body, they might be 
overridden they are like in CURVED_LETTERS.

In short it must either dispatch on the actual argument or else the 
argument must be converted to LETTERS in a way that LETTERS operations 
would yield the correct result.

Neither is possible.
